DTB reviews β β β β β
Really good escape room. We completed the operation sealion escape room. It was a hard escape room so keep that in mindif you are interested in it. We escaped with 3 minutes to spare with a group of 4 people I feel that it could be done with 3 but may be a bit more channelnging. You can have up to 6 people which would be possible and would likely make things a bit simpiler but i winder if there could be times some people may not have something to do but aslong as you divide tasks between you it would be fine. It think 4 was a good number for the room. The escape room was great fun with a great theme and good puzzles. The staff were very freindly and helpfull if you needed them for any issues. Will definelty recommend to others and I will likely come back to do the other rooms.

We had a great time playing Old Maid Milly and Cabin in the woods! We've played over a hundred rooms so was interested to play this new start-up last weekend. Old maid Milly is definitely a room I'd recommend for beginners to escape rooms; it had a good theme and accessible puzzles. We completed it as a pair in just under 30 minutes but still really enjoyed the room. The cabin in the woods was a different beast! Lots of puzzles, lots to do and a little more brain power required! We still escaped well within time. We had a brilliant time and felt the rooms made sense, with minimal nudges required to keep us on track. We'll play the other room if we return to the area for sure!
